Output 65a28e4d99cef609d877774f3b431b92cb030b88fdc1a5df54810c3d6722a105:3

value
4042500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8301180d1fb5bdeaaecb4d1a41ec85163d1d74 OP_EQUAL
address
3K9dvX71NpLN2Aq9axXfWorFmByNDNDwB4
transaction
65a28e4d99cef609d877774f3b431b92cb030b88fdc1a5df54810c3d6722a105
spent
true